Traveling in off-peak train times
Off-Peak train tickets are generally cheaper than peak-time tickets, allowing travel outside morning (6:30 AM–9:30 AM) and evening (4:00 PM–7:00 PM) rush hours on weekdays. If your schedule allows for flexibility, choosing off-peak times for your trip from Partick to Mallaig can result in significant cost savings.

Split tickets to save an average extra 30%
Splitting tickets involves buying separate, cheaper tickets for different parts of your journey on the same train instead of just one ticket for the entire trip. For instance, if you're traveling from Partick to Mallaig, you might find that purchasing a ticket from A to C, then C to B costs less than a direct ticket. This method is perfectly legal and often doesn't require leaving your seat.

Book in advance to save an average of 61%
Advance Tickets are typically released up to 12 weeks before the travel date and can offer significant savings compared to tickets purchased closer to departure. By planning your trip from Partick to Mallaig ahead of time and booking your tickets early, you can potentially save up to 61% on your travel expenses.
